“Pistaaa: Piedmont’s Blue Way”: the strong link between art and sustainability in a new bike and pedestrian path A new trail between the Piedmontese towns of Casalborgone and Aramengo will open on 7 May, in addition to the many already existing. The signage, which when framed through an information app brings up the list of the sustainable organisations in the area, gives a space for local artists to revisit the Third Paradise. From Palazzo Reale with an eye on the world, Michelangelo Pistoletto’s exhibition “The Preventive Peace” opens in Milan Last night, Palazzo Reale hosted the vernissage of the new exhibition project by the Biellese artist, which will be open from today - Thursday 23 March - until Sunday 4 June 2023. The exhibition "The Preventive Peace" articulates in the immersive experience of the work "Labyrinth", and the result is a disorienting journey among the artist's works that leads the visitor along the itinerary of awareness that has guided Pistoletto in conceiving "art at the centre of a responsible transformation of society". “Fashion for Planet Open Parliament”, a civic parliament convened by art for fashion and the planet in Milan Fashion met sustainability in a mosaic of collective exchanges: during Milan Fashion Week, the National Chamber of Italian Fashion and Cittadellarte Fashion B.E.S.T. proposed an open parliament in the Sala del Parlamentino of Palazzo Giureconsulti, which for the occasion became a space for listening to the "voices of nature". The initiative saw the participation of philosophers, artists, entrepreneurs, journalists, designers, students and people from all walks of life and sectors who spoke with, for and on behalf of the planet. “Clothes are our second skin,” said Michelangelo Pistoletto, “we must be creatively responsible”. Rome, DART – Chiostro del Bramante hosts the Michelangelo Pistoletto exhibition “Infinity – Contemporary art without limits” The exhibition project dedicated to the artist from Biella at DART - Chiostro del Bramante will run from 18 March to 15 October 2023. The exhibition, curated by Danilo Eccher, features fifty works and four large site-specific installations in an itinerary that covers the entire career of Michelangelo Pistoletto, from the 1960s to more recent works. “Cultural diplomacy”, a webinar on the Third Paradise at the Espronceda Institute of Art & Culture On 14 January, the Espronceda Institute of Art and Culture in Barcelona proposed a talk dedicated to Michelangelo Pistoletto's sign-symbol, to the practice of the Biellese artist and to Cittadellarte. Speaking at the event – attended by remote international participants – was Saverio Teruzzi, coordinator of the Rebirth/Third Paradise project, with Savina Tarsitano, Rebirth/Third Paradise ambassador, as moderator. The webinar, part of the new project "Cultural Diplomacy", focusing on the concepts of peace and solidarity, was organised in cooperation with the German Consulate in Barcelona, with the patronage of ENCATC (European Network on Cultural management and policy) and the collaboration of the international project "Kids-Guernica", the European Culture Parliament, the cultural association "Embajada del art" and "Guernica Remakings". The Third Paradise and Inner Developement Goals From sustainable development goals to inner development goals: Edoardo Marcenaro, head of the legal department of Enel Grids, after speaking at the Rebirth/Third Paradise ambassadors' meeting last weekend, offers his reflections and insights on the topic. “Inner Development Goals is a non-profit open-source organisation,” he said, “for the inner development, research, collection and communication of science-based skills and qualities that can help us live a purposeful, sustainable and productive life”. As Marcenaro reported, the current framework of the Inner Development Goals indicates five categories and twenty-three skills and qualities which are especially crucial in accelerating the achievement of the SDGs. The five categories (being, thinking, relating, collaborating and acting) and the related skills and capabilities are fundamental tools to put in place a practical action plan on how to achieve the 2030 Agenda. When art meets sustainable fashion: the third edition of “Circulart” has been presented The protagonists of this year’s edition are two international artists and two international fashion designers, selected through an open call launched by Cittadellarte: Augustina Bottoni, Lucia Chain, Huge Sillytoe and Rebecca Sforzani, young talents called upon to create a work with fabrics produced by partner companies, focusing on dialogue and on the enhancement of the textile industry production chain. “CirculART is a research and innovation format with which we have now been experimenting for three years,” said Paolo Naldini, director of Cittadellarte - Fondazione Pistoletto, “we start by identifying the challenges that companies deem as most urgent, and then explore possible lines of development with artists and experts from different sectors”. A new tapestry of the Third Paradise at Cosenza Cathedral As part of the celebrations for the 800th anniversary of the cultural and spiritual hub in Calabria, the cathedral is exhibiting sixteen large tapestries on religious, biblical and evangelical themes by international artists.
